Apple has updated Pages, Numbers, and Keynote for Mac with support for real-time collaboration, wide color gamut images, and more.
What's New In Pages: • Real-time collaboration (feature in beta) - Edit a document with others at the same time in Pages on Mac, iPad, iPhone, and iCloud.com - Share your document publicly or with specific people - See who else is in a document - See participants’ cursors as they’re editing
• Open and edit Pages ’05 documents • Use tabs to work with multiple documents in one window • Wide color gamut image support
What's New In Numbers: • Real-time collaboration (feature in beta) - Edit a spreadsheet with others at the same time in Numbers on Mac, iPad, iPhone, and iCloud.com - Share your spreadsheet publicly or with specific people - See who else is in a spreadsheet - See participants’ cursors as they’re editing
• Use tabs to work with multiple spreadsheets in one window • Wide color gamut image support
What's New In Keynote: • Real-time collaboration (feature in beta) - Edit a presentation with others at the same time in Keynote on Mac, iPad, iPhone, and iCloud.com - Share your presentation publicly or with specific people - See who else is in a presentation - See participants’ cursors as they’re editing
• Keynote Live lets you present a slideshow that viewers can follow from their Mac, iPad, iPhone, and from iCloud.com • Open and edit Keynote ’05 presentations • Use tabs to work with multiple presentations in one window • Wide color gamut image support
